  .... Segmentation fault when loading HTTPS pages
  
  Binary package hint: firefox
  
  Firefox is consistently crashing when the following steps are executed:
  
  1) open firefox in a terminal:
  
  firefox
  
  2) open any http URL that automatically redirects to a https one (I've
  tested with http://launchpad.net/ and http://mail.yahoo.com/).
  
  3) As soon as the page redirects to the https site (but before page is
  fully loaded), close the window.
  
  4) Firefox will crash and the following message will appear on console:
  
  (Gecko:5751): GLib-GObject-WARNING **: invalid uninstantiatable type
  `(null)' in cast to `GtkWidget'
  
  (Gecko:5751): GLib-GObject-WARNING **: invalid uninstantiatable type
  `(null)' in cast to `GObject'
  
  (Gecko:5751): GLib-GObject-CRITICAL **: g_object_get_data: assertion `G_IS_OBJECT (object)' failed
  Segmentation fault (core dumped)
  
  Environment:
  
  - Ubuntu Edgy (latest updates)
  - firefox 1.99+2.0rc3+dfsg-0ubuntu1
